Dimorphic Mating Pair of Lepturines - Anastrangalia laetifica - male - female

Dimorphic Mating Pair of Lepturines - Anastrangalia laetifica - Male Female
Near town of Shaver Lake, Sierra National Forest, Fresno County, California, USA
July 11, 2010
Beautiful pair of Lepturines from the same lovely montane meadow as this one and this one. Looks like they're perched on a nice pink-flowered form of Yarrow (Achillea millefolium).
